const mapSettings = document.getElementById('map-settings'); //const board = document.getElementById('board'); const map = document.getElementById('map'); const spinner = document.getElementById('spinner'); mapSettings.addEventListener('submit', (e) => { console.log('form submit'); e.preventDefault(); spinner.classList.remove('d-none'); map.src = '/map?q=' + (new Date()).getTime(); map.classList.add('d-none'); }); map.addEventListener('load', () => { spinner.classList.add('d-none'); map.classList.remove('d-none'); });